Why read it?

1 author picked The King at the Edge of the World as one of their favorite books. Why do they recommend it?

One thing that makes a book great is its uniqueness.

This story of a Turkish physician who finds himself in the court of Queen Elizabeth I and who becomes involved in the intrigue concerning the success of James I is unlike anything I’ve read before. It felt thoroughly authentic and compelling.

While thephysician's charactern is fictional, the period’s conflict between Protestants and Catholics is very real and was an added, informative element of the novel.
